New fridge-free vaccine could be transformative (medicalxpress.com) Health & Science

Community icongoodnewseveryone@piefed.social by
Rimu@piefed.social
he/him 10 hours ago

Around half of vaccines are wasted each year globally, according to the World Health Organization. Many are lost because they get too hot or cold. The scale of the loss prompted scientists to work on fridge-free versions of common vaccines - and this week one such vaccine showed promise in a world-first trial.

New Mexico Court Orders Meta to Pay to Establish $567 Million Fund to Abate Harms to Youth (techpolicy.press)

Community icontechnology@lemmy.world by
beep@piefed.world
9 hours ago

On Thursday, the First Judicial District Court in Santa Fe, New Mexico issued a decision in the remedies phase of State of New Mexico v. Meta Platforms Inc. The court found Meta’s platforms created a public nuisance by contributing to the youth mental health crisis and by facilitating child sexual exploitation. It ordered a range of remedies, including the creation of a $567 million abatement fund to finance various measures intended to address the harms to the public.
